CALGARY, Alberta--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Feb. 7, 2005--Agrium Inc.(NYSE:AGU) (TSX:AGU) announced today plans to proceed with detailed engineering on a proposed expansion of its controlled release urea fertilizer product "ESN®" at the Carseland, Alberta nitrogen facility in response to overwhelming demand. The proposed expansion would increase ESN® coating capability from 30,000 to 150,000 tonnes of product per year. Should the project proceed to construction, the additional product would be available in the market as early as January 2006.

ESN®, or Smart Nitrogen, has a unique semi-permeable polymer coating that allows water to enter the urea granule and dissolve the nitrogen. The nitrogen release rate is controlled by soil temperature, which similarly determines plant growth and nutrient demand. Therefore, ESN® technology provides for a better matching of nutrient availability in the soil with plant nutrient requirements. The result is increased productivity per pound of nitrogen, providing an economic advantage for growers, while reducing nitrogen loss to the environment.

ESN® was awarded both Farm Industry News's FinOvation Award for the top product in the Crop Chemicals category as well as was named one of the Top 10 New Technologies by the Canadian Association of Agricultural Retailers. Additionally, the Government of Canada, through the Environmental Technology Assessment for Agriculture (ETAA) program, awarded Agrium with a $500,000 (Canadian) grant to fund research on controlled release fertilizers such as ESN® and controlled release phosphates over the next three years. The ETAA program identifies and assesses technologies to advance beneficial management practices on the farm.
